Three Mississippians Drafted in the First Three Rounds of the NFL Draft

DETROIT, MI. (WJTV)- Three Mississippians were drafted in the first three rounds of the NFL Draft!

Brandon, native Jarrian Jones (Northwest High School) was picked in the 3rd round (96th overall) by the Jacksonville Jaguars!

Greenville, native Trey Benson was picked in the 2nd round (66th overall) by the Arizona Cardinals.

Finally, Lucedale native McKinnley Jackson was picked in the 3rd round (97th overall) by the Cincinnati Bengals.
